Ingredients and spices that need to be Prepare to make Stuffed Pork Loin:

  1. 1/2 pork loin (4-5 lbs)
  2. 10 oz baby spinach
  3. 2 oz blueberry goat cheese
  4. 3/4 oz basil; chiffonade
  5. 2 roasted red bell peppers; medium dice
  6. 2 garlic cloves; minced
  7. 1 lemon; juiced & zested
  8. 1 small red onion; julienne
  9. 1 T fresh rosemary; minced
  10. as needed kosher salt & black pepper
  11. as needed olive oil

Steps to make to make Stuffed Pork Loin

  1. In a large mixing bowl, combine ingredients spinach through salt and pepper. Mix together.
  2. Butterfly pork loin down center, but do not cut all the way through.
  3. Lay pork loin between seran wrap on a large work surface.
  4. Pound thin with a mallet or blunt object.
  5. Place cheese and vegetable mixture along the center. Fold over pork loin. Alternatively, pound pork super thin and spread out mixture all over but leave 1 inch of space along one side of the pork to close the loin. Roll up the pork to make a roulade.
  6. Drizzle olive oil over pork loin. Season with kosher salt, black pepper, and rosemary on both sides.
  7. Lay pork loin on a baking tray lined with parchment paper. Bake at 350° for approximately 40 minutes or until pork reaches desired doneness.
